Northpark Mall is a super regional mall located in Joplin, MO. Northpark Mall, located on Range Line Road on the east side of Joplin, first opened its doors in 1972. When it first opened, Montgomery Ward was located to the north, JCPenney was located to the south, and Newman’s was located in the middle. Other stores included Walgreens, McCrory’s, Ramsay’s Department Store, For All Bible (which moved out in 2016, and permanently closed the next year), Wyatts cafeteria, as well as many other stores.

Newman’s was renamed Heer’s in 1987, the same year that a new wing was constructed and the mall underwent its first major remodeling project. The new wing of the JCPenney shop stretched eastward from the existing one. Famous-Barr and Venture, two new anchors, were installed in this new wing.

A food court was also added as part of the refurbishment, as well as a new 5-screen cinema. Heer’s closed its doors in 1994, and Famous-Barr relocated its men’s apparel and home goods operations to the former Heer’s location. Sears opened a new store next to Montgomery Ward in the same year, relocating from an older store in downtown Joplin’s downtown area. The mall underwent a brief refurbishment in 1998, with the color scheme being the only thing that was changed.

In 1998, the mall’s anchor store was changed to Shopko after the Venture chain went out of business. However, Shopko went out of business in the early 2000s as a result of the closure of Montgomery Ward in 2001. Famous-Barr stores in both New York and Los Angeles were rebranded as Macy’s in 2006.

It was not until mid-2007 that Montgomery Ward was repurposed, with its space being shared by TJ Maxx and Steve & Barry’s, the latter of which closed in 2008 and was replaced by Vintage Stock. In 2006, the mall underwent its first major refurbishment in nearly 20 years, with the color scheme being changed, all new lighting and floor tiles installed, and the food court being transformed into a Route 66-themed restaurant.

In December 2015, For-All Bible announced that they would be relocating to a new site outside of a shopping mall. For-All Bible was one of the final original tenants in the mall, and they were forced to close its doors permanently in 2017, leaving JCPenney as the sole remaining original tenant in the shopping center.
